The automotive industry is another major application area for resistors designed for high voltage circuits. With the shift toward electric vehicles (EVs) and hybrid vehicles, there is a growing need for high voltage components that can safely manage power in electric drivetrains and charging systems. High voltage resistors are used in battery management systems, power inverters, and electric motor controllers to ensure proper voltage regulation and prevent overheating, making them essential for the safe operation of EVs and hybrids.
As the automotive sector embraces electrification and autonomous driving technologies, the demand for advanced high voltage resistors continues to rise. Manufacturers are focusing on creating more compact, durable, and cost-effective resistors to support the growing complexity of vehicle electrical systems. Additionally, the trend of integrating renewable energy sources and charging infrastructure into vehicles also contributes to the expanding market for resistors in automotive applications. High voltage resistors are increasingly seen as vital components for enhancing the performance and safety of modern vehicles, particularly in the electric and hybrid segments.
In the aerospace sector, high voltage resistors are critical for ensuring the reliability and stability of electrical systems used in aircraft, satellites, and spacecraft. These resistors are employed in high-power applications, such as avionics systems, power distribution units, and propulsion systems, where precise voltage control is necessary for optimal performance and safety. The aerospace industry requires components that can withstand extreme environmental conditions, and high voltage resistors are designed to operate efficiently under high temperatures, radiation, and vibration.
The continued advancement of aerospace technologies, including electric propulsion systems and satellite communication systems, drives the demand for high voltage resistors that offer high reliability and durability. The growth in space exploration, commercial aviation, and defense applications further intensifies the need for specialized resistors capable of handling high voltage circuits in challenging environments. As aerospace manufacturers prioritize safety, performance, and energy efficiency, the market for high voltage resistors is poised for steady growth in the coming years.
The "Others" segment includes various other applications of high voltage resistors in industries such as telecommunications, industrial equipment, power generation, and medical devices. In telecommunications, high voltage resistors are used in power supplies for base stations and network equipment, ensuring stable operation in high-power applications. Similarly, in the power generation sector, these resistors are essential for regulating voltage in power plants and renewable energy systems, helping to maintain grid stability and efficiency.
In industrial equipment, high voltage resistors are integrated into machinery used in manufacturing and automation, where they help protect circuits from voltage spikes and improve operational efficiency. In the medical device sector, resistors are critical in diagnostic equipment and imaging systems, where precision and reliability are paramount. As industries continue to develop more advanced technologies, the demand for high voltage resistors across these diverse sectors is expected to increase, presenting ample opportunities for market growth.
